WebThe IPSSWM was derived after merging a cohort of patients with WM from 7 international co-operative groups. The IPSSWM speicifcially focuse on symptomatic patinets requiring therapy, and the majority were treated with standard therapies including alkylating agents, … WebWe identified age (≤65 vs 66–75 vs ≥76 years), b2-microglobulin ≥ 4 mg/L, serum albumin <3.5 gr/dl, and LDH ≥ 250 IU/L (ULN < 225) to stratify patients in five different prognostic groups and identify a very-low risk as well as a very-high risk group with a 3-year WM-related death rate of 0, 10, 14, 38, and 48% (p < 0.001) and 10-year survival … in 2005 bankruptcy reform laws https://tierralab.org

FCR was repeated every 28 days for up to 6 courses. RESULTS: WebFeb 11, 2024 · However, the IPSSWM score is based upon measurements at diagnosis, not at first treatment. This reduces their utility, as scores are likely to change over time. The Registry plans to use the 2024 revised IPSSWM2 going forward.
